Since this is a temporary kind of thing, I did this with no soldering and twisted the wires together like so:

Strip a good bit of insulation from your pairing wires, bring them alongside eachother and twist the strands into eachother until they're tight, now fold the twisted part over and twist this, that ensures a good connection and it's very strong compared to a few twists and a bit of tape.
